Given our rural roads and harsh winters, we frequently service Ford trucks and SUVs for suspension components worn by rough terrain and corrosion from road salt. For models like the F-150 and Explorer, common issues also include 4WD system maintenance and brake work due to stop-and-go driving on gravel and county highways.

You should have the system inspected if you notice unusual noises when engaged or difficulty switching modes, especially before winter. Proactive service in the fall is wise, as our snowy and muddy seasons demand a reliable 4WD system for navigating unplatted roads and fields.

Plan major service around the agricultural seasons, as local shops may be busier during planting and harvest. Also, schedule pre-winter checks early to avoid the rush for battery, tire, and coolant services needed to handle Iowa's cold snaps and ensure reliable starts.
